(Campus Services IT) Remember: EMIX is Price and Product communication. Period. What are we buying. What are we selling. How do we describe the product. EnergyInterop is the interactions to acquire energy, including
the important acquiring someone else’s negative consumption. EnergyInterop is
where contracts for energy behavior and deliveries are offered, executed, and
performed. The message payload for EnergyInterop is usually EMIX. Quality is a part of the Product. It must also be separable to
describe the actual delivery. This sounds like a separate component within
EMIX. TWIST looks like an EnergyInterop thing. All three of David’s tiers look like EnergyInterop things to me. We keep going down these ratholes. We need to stay in the scope
of the respective charters. “The OASIS eMIX TC works to
define standards for exchanging energy characteristics, availability, and

(XML) [mailto:david@drrw.info] Toby, I'm still grappling with all this - and seeing we need tiered
layers and clear separation. Right now we seem to be mixing it all into one big cement mixer
and grinding it up - that is NOT good! OK - so who many types of EMIX messages are we building? - Tier 1 - eMarketplace for commodity trading (EMIX-CT) - Tier 2 - Contract, marketplace and delivery management
(EMIX-eBay) - Tier 3 - Power delivery (EMIX-PWR) I'd suggest that Tier 1 - we really need to look at existing stuff
- like TWIST - instead of reinventing the wheel. And then just publish a
TWIST-EMIX profile and workflow patterns with specific power-centric criteria /
codelists / vocabulary. Similarly Tier 2 - OASIS ebXML Contract work covers this already -
again just need a profile showing how. Tier 3 - OK - this is IMHO where we do build XML - maybe two sets
EMIX-PWR (power exchange) and EMIX-GRID (device configuration) So the answer to the question is Yes! But lets see how to do
that using existing work like TWIST...? Thanks, DW
